Silverlight后台线程中未处理异常的事件?

时间:2009-08-20 08:58:09

标签: silverlight multithreading exception-handling

Silverlight是否有可用的等效AppDomain.UnhandledException?我说可用,因为虽然该方法存在于Silverlight中,但MSDN将其标记为[SecurityCritical]

我想要的是接收有关在后台或ThreadPool线程上发生异常的通知,以便我可以记录它们。 Application.UnhandledException是另一个候选者,但看起来只能从UI线程中收到异常。

1 个答案:

答案 0 :(得分:6)

您使用的是Silverlight 3吗?我只是将一个简单的SL3应用程序放在一起,该应用程序显示Application.UnhandledException已通知来自UI线程,线程池线程,工作线程和后台工作线程的未处理异常。

你可能过早地说服了自己。 :)